Time Warner Cable W Birmingham

Time Warner Cable W Birmingham

Business To Business in W Birmingham, AL

Business To Business IT Services & Computers

Contact us

Location

1133 3rd Ave ,
W Birmingham , AL 35208 UNITED STATES

About Time Warner Cable W Birmingham

Buy from Local dealer and get piece of mind.

Photos

Reviews

Time Warner Cable W Birmingham 205-208-4120
1133 3rd Ave ,
W Birmingham , AL 35208 UNITED STATES
$
Time Warner Cable W Birmingham

Detail information

Company name
Time Warner Cable W Birmingham
Category
Business To Business
Rating
Not Rated
Tags
telecommunications,  satellite equipment & system dealers,  cable television equipment
Is this your business? Manage via YEXT
edit delete

Time Warner Cable W Birmingham

Contacts Location About Photos Details